首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
关于运算符重载,下列表述中正确的是( )。
关于运算符重载,下列表述中正确的是( )。
admin
2016-09-20
79
问题
关于运算符重载,下列表述中正确的是( )。
选项
A、C抖已有的任何运算符都可以重载
B、运算符函数的返回类型不能声明为基本数据类型
C、在类型转换符函数的定义中不需要声明返回类型
D、可以通过运算符重载来创建C++中原来没有的运算符
答案
C
解析
重载运算符的规则如下:①C++不允许用户自己定义新的运算符,只能对已有的C++运算符进行重载;②C++不能重载的运算符只有5个;③重载不能改变运算符运算对象的个数;④重载不能改变运算符的优先级和结合性;⑤重载运算符的函数不能有默认的参数;⑥重载的运算符必须和用户定义的自定义类型的对象一起使用,至少应有一个是类对象,即不允许参数全部是C++的标准类型。故本题答案为C。
转载请注明原文地址:https://www.kaotiyun.com/show/vpNp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
数据结构作为计算机的一门学科,主要研究数据的逻辑结构、对各种数据结构进行的运算,以及
将一个函数声明为一个类的友元函数必须使用关键字【】。
函数sstrcmp()的功能是对两个字符串进行比较。当s所指字符串和t所指字符串相等时,返回值为0:当s所指字符串大于t所指字符串时,返回值大于0;当s所指字符串大于t所指字符串时,返回值大于0(功能等同于strcmp())。请填空。intSs
常用的关系运算是关系代数和()。
若有以下程序:#include<iostream>usingnamespacestd;classdata{public:intx;data(intx){
下面程序的输出结果是【】。#include<iostream.h>voidmain(){inta[6]={1,2,3,4,5,6};for(inti=0;i<5;i++)
数据模型按不同应用层次分成3种类型,它们是概念数据模型、【】和物理数据模型。
下面的说明中,正确的函数定义是()。
软件开发离不开系统环境资源的支持,其中必要的测试数据属于
随机试题
关于行政处罚强制执行的表述,错误的是()
影响气道阻力的主要原因是
主动脉弓的分支有
监理大纲的编制目的是()。
甲公司为居民企业,主要从事不锈钢用品的生产和销售业务,其2016年实际发生的下列支出中,在计算2016年度企业所得税应纳税所得额时允许扣除的有()
下列谱例是哪位作曲家的哪部作品?()
“实现全面建成小康社会的总目标,需要完善和发展中国特色社会主义制度、政策、战略、方针。”下列关于中国特色社会主义政治制度表述正确的是()。
男性,25岁。因车轮压伤致左胫腓骨上1/3处开放性粉碎性骨折,行彻底清创术,去除所有游离碎骨片,术后给予牵引固定,但3个月后骨折仍不愈合,其最大可能的原因是
历史进步的曲折性和反复性的根本原因是( )
AccordingtotheUNICEF,howmanychildrenaretraffickedeachyear?
最新回复
(
0
)